Stamp Ink Paper Challenge #70 - Tic Tac Toe


Hello and Happy Tuesday!  I hope you are having a fabulous week!  I'm counting down to my vacation that is just 2 weeks away and getting more and more excited every day!  Today over at Stamp, Ink, Paper we have a fun Tic-Tac-Toe Challenge! 


I totally had another card in mind but once I started working on my planned card I decided it against it.  Instead this is what I came up with!  This fit in right across the bottom row for Orange, Ribbon/Twine and Punch/Die Cut!


 I started looking around my craft area and found some left over watercolor paper that already had a three color wash on it and had Gina Marie Oak Leaves die cut out of it.  I decided to cut the oak leaves out of Pumpkin Pie Cardstock and inlay them into the negative space.   I cut the watercolor paper panel 3 3/4" x 5" and stamped the sentiment from the retired Lighthearted Leaves set in the lower left in Chocolate Chip Ink. The Pumpkin Pie Die Cut Oak Leaves were glued into the negative space with Tombow Multipurpose Glue.  I ran Tangerine Tango baker's twine along the left side three times and tied it in a bow toward the bottom.  I adhered this panel onto Old Olive A2 Card Base.  I was super happy with how it turned out!  I'm usually not a clean & simple girl but this is pretty close!

Here's my card and project for you this month...


I was super excited to get my new Stampin' Up! Spooky Fun stamp set and coordinating Halloween Scenes Edgelits Dies to use on this card!


For my card, I went with traditional (to me) Halloween colors... Pumpkin Pie, Elegant Eggplant, Basic Black and Basic Gray.  My cardbase is an 8 1/2" x 5 1/2" piece of Pumpkin Pie cardstock scored at 4 1/4" for a standard A2 Card Base.  The next layer is a 5 1/4" x 4" piece of Elegant Eggplant that had been stamped in Elegant Eggplant Ink with the Watercolor Wash background stamp.  I punched out a circle in Pumpkin Pie for the moon and stamped it with the 2nd generation of the Elegant Eggplant Watercolor Wash stamp.  I adhered that to the Purple layer in the upper right section.  The next layer is Basic Black that was also 5 1/4" x 4" and was cut with the Tree scene die and adhered with Fast Fuse over the purple so that some of the branches are in the moon.  I die cut a bat out of a scrap of basic black and added that over the moon as well.  Next up is the fence scene that was cut out from a 4" x 4" wide scrap of Basic Gray Cardstock.  The Happy Halloween sentiment was stamped on it in Elegant Eggplant on the bottom right before adhering this to the card front.  I stamped the pumpkins in Basic Black Archival Ink onto Pumpkin Pie Cardstock and die cut them with the dies from the Halloween Scenes Edgelits Dies.  I adhered them with Dimensionals right over the sentiment.  Last but never least, I added some Pretty Pink Posh Purple and Silver Sequins from the Enchanted Garden Mix.  I bought these from Justin Krieger at his Stamp, Ink, Paper Store!  I LOVE these colors in this mix!


The inside of my card had a 4 x 5 1/4" piece of Elegant Eggplant Cardstock as well as a 3 3/4" x 5" piece of Very Vanilla Cardstock.  The spiders were stamped in Basic Black Archival Ink in the upper right corner.  The sentiment was stamped in Elegant Eggplant Ink.  Finally, some die cut pumpkins done the same as the ones on the front of the card were added in the lower left side.  


The Pumpkin Curvy Keepsake Box was cut from Pumpkin Pie Cardstock and striped with a sponge dauber in Pumpkin Pie Ink.   The Leaves are stamped Tone-on-Tone on Old Olive Cardstock with the Vintage Leaves Stamp set and cut out with the Leaflet Framelits Dies.  They were adhered with Tombo Multipurpose Glue.  I tied a bow with some Green Seam Binding.  The tag also from the Curvy Keepsake Framelits was cut out in a scrap of Sahara Sand and tied on with Linen Thread.  This pumpkin turned out super cute and I think it would make an awesome place setting or treat box!

I decided to use an awesome Unity Stamp Set called No Remedy for Love.  There are so many awesome sentiments in that set.  I'm a sucker for awesome sentiment sets!  Here's my card...


Since the challenge badge is Fall in Love, I first decided to go with some fall colors.  I started with  Bristol Watercolor Paper as a base for a watercolor wash.  I used Aqua Painters and the inks used were Pumpkin Pie, Pear Pizzazz, and Daffodil Delight.   Once the background wash was dry I used my Stampin' Up Archival Black Ink to stamp my sentiment and then I heat embossed it with clear embossing powder.  Next the sentiment was cut out, as well as a piece of Pumpkin Pie Cardstock,  with My Favorite Things Stitched Rounded Rectangle Dies. From the extra watercolor wash, I cut out some leaves with the Gina Marie Oak Leaves Dies.. no need to waste a good watercolor wash, right??  The Pear Pizzazz cardstock measured 5 1/2" x 8 1/2" and was scored at 4 1/4".  The next   layer was a piece of 5 1/4" x 4" Daffodil Delight background paper that had a piece of green seam binding attached and knotted on the left side.  Fast fuse was used to attach the Pumpkin Pie stitched layer and dimensionals were used to attach the sentiment layer.  The Gina Marie Oak Leaves with adhered with Fast Fuse.

I decided to use my Cookie Cutter Halloween set for this card but I wanted a field of grain for my scarecrow to stand in and of course, he needed a pole!  For my grain, I used one of the stamps from Jar of Love and stamped it in Delightful Dijon both in full color and in second generation stamping.  I also alternated stamping on and off the cardstock so that it was different heights.  After stamping, I sponged some Daffodil Delight Ink onto the bottom portion of my Whisper White layer.  I also sponged some Soft Sky Ink onto the top portion of this layer lightly in the middle and darker around the edges.  I made my pole by stamping the woodgrain from the Timeless Textures stamp set in Soft Suede ink onto Crumb Cake Cardstock.  I then cut a strip at about 1/4" wide x 3" long for the pole  .  I adhered it to my stamped layer with fast fuse.  I stamped my Scarecrow and Bird onto Watercolor Paper with Black Archival Ink. I then watercolored the scarecrow with Old Olive, Tangerine Tango, Delightful Dijon, Crumb Cake and Pumpkin Pie ink. I punched him out with the coordinating Cookie Cutter Builder Punch.  I fussy cut the bird and then attached them both with Stampin' Dimensionals.  I stamped the sentiment from Acorny Thank You in Black Archival Ink onto Whisper White Cardstock and cut it out with the Lots of Labels Framelits Dies.  I sponged the edges of it with Daffodil Delight Ink and adhered it with Stampin' Dimensionals as well.
